Eligibility Criteria

The candidate must have a minimum Bachelor’s Degree from a recognised university, with at least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A in any discipline. Candidates appearing in the final year/semester of the degree program can also apply subject to fulfilling the above notified eligibility criteria. The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ent qualification obtained by the candidate must entail a minimum of three years of education after completing higher secondary schooling (10+2) or equivalent.

Admission Details

Candidates who have appeared for CAT, XAT, CMAT, NMAT, MAT, GMAT will be shortlisted directly to appear for the interview process. The cut-off scores to apply are – CAT/XAT – 50 Percentile CMAT/MAT/NMAT – 60 Percentile and GMAT – 400 marks Those who have not taken any entrance exam can take the Pearl Academy General Proficiency Test.

On the basis of the GPT performance or the national level examination scores, only the shortlisted candidates will be called for Personal Interviews.
